Dating Confidence Reset: Clear Goals, Calm Pace, Real Progress
Start by clarifying what you actually want. Decide whether you’re exploring, open to something serious, or just looking for casual conversation. Writing a one-sentence intention helps you screen matches and steer conversations without overthinking.
Keep expectations realistic. Online dating is a process, not a promise. Treat each message or date as a data point: useful information that refines what you look for, not a verdict on your worth. Pace yourself by limiting how much time you spend swiping and messaging each day so you don’t burn out.
Pace conversations with purpose. Move from small talk to meaningful questions in a few steps: shared interests, values, and then practical logistics. If someone responds slowly or inconsistently, match their tempo rather than chasing faster replies. That preserves energy and reveals who’s genuinely interested.
Notice progress, not just outcomes. Celebrate clearer profiles, better first messages, or a conversation that lasts three quality messages instead of one. These are signs you’re improving your type of connection. Keep a simple note of what worked so you repeat it.
Choose matches more thoughtfully. Look beyond photos and headlines: scan for a few concrete shared interests or lifestyle cues that matter to you. Use your intention to decide quickly whether to invest time—if a profile doesn’t show the basics you care about, it’s okay to skip.
Protect your emotional steady state. Set small habits that keep you grounded: a walk after a tough chat, a 10‑minute break before replying, or a reminder of one personal quality you like about yourself. If rejection happens, treat it like useful feedback, not a character judgment.
Keep curiosity, lose the numbers game. Instead of measuring success by matches or replies, measure it by whether a conversation taught you something or moved you closer to your intention. Quality over quantity helps you stay confident and selective without becoming discouraged.
